Successful Ielts Coaching Uzbekistan ([https://telegra.ph/](https://telegra.ph/The-10-Most-Scariest-Things-About-Registered-Ielts-Certificate-Uzbekistan-03-30)) preparation requires commitment and strategic planning. Here are some effective ideas for candidates:

Understand the Test Format: Familiarize yourself with the four sections: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.

Practice Regularly: Consistent practice is important. Arrange regular mock tests to evaluate your development.

Boost Your Vocabulary: A robust vocabulary can substantially impact your writing and speaking scores.

Look for Feedback: Utilize feedback from trainers or peers to determine locations for enhancement.

Imitate Exam Conditions: Practice under timed conditions to get accustomed to the pressure of the actual test.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How long should I get ready for the IELTS?
A1: Preparation time varies based upon private proficiency, however a timeline of 6-12 weeks is often advised for a lot of candidates.
Q2: Are online training classes as efficient as in-person classes?
A2: Online training can be similarly effective, especially if taught by qualified trainers. The main benefit is flexibility; nevertheless, some individuals choose the direct interaction of in-person classes.
Q3: What score do I require to accomplish for university admission?
A3: Most universities require an overall band score of 6.0 to 7.5, depending upon the institution and program.
Q4: Can I retake the IELTS if I am not satisfied with my rating?
A4: Yes, candidates can retake the [Ielts Uzbekistan Writing Samples](https://porterfield-nymand.federatedjournals.com/the-hidden-secrets-of-ielts-speaking-tips-uzbekistan) as typically as they want. It is suggested to recognize and work on weaker locations before reattempting.
Q5: How can I choose the right coaching center for my IELTS preparation?
A5: Consider aspects such as course content, trainer credentials, class size, and student evaluations. Visit prospective centers if possible to examine their environment.
